new place, same great taste. distinguished local chef matthew porco, formerly of mio kitchen & wine bar, received a few of our best restaurants awards (including 2010 chef of the year). not surprisingly, buzz has been building about sienna sulla piazza, a new italian eatery situated in market square that will feature the chef’s work. sienna, one of few regional eateries that received certification from the green restaurant association, strives to provide diners with an exceptional experience. the menu includes such dishes as pasta fagioli and tomato risotto. if you were a mio fan, it looks like you’re in luck.

delicious italian close to the cultural district. sienna is a great restaurant that offers a huge menu of housemade dishes. the mixture of outdoor/indoor seating is nice and service is friendly, though slow. we were seated at the large bar area and it seemed that the single bartender was overloaded. we had to wait long periods before being presented with menus or asked about our order, though dining with a pre-show crowd has that effect i guess. the food easily makes up for the slow service though!

pros:
1. decently priced meal options, with appetizers in the low $10s and entrees between $15-30.
2. offers a variety of housemade sauces and pastas (and you can definitely tell it’s made in house)
3. we got the following dishes and they were simply amazing:
rabbit and housemade tagiatelle
handmade papperdelle bolognese (pay extra to get the mozzarella meatball, it’s worth it!)
4. also offer delicious looking , huge salads and flatbreads. we saw a lot of mouth-watering flatbreads coming out of the kitchen with a mound of greens.

cons:
1. service is slow at the bar area
2. complimentary crab dip is yummy but the accompanying bread is pretty bland

overall, i highly recommend this place for market square dining. it’s delicious, has nice outdoor seating and the effort the restaurant puts into making items in house is clearly reflected in the food.
